How Gas Insulated Switchgear Works

At the heart of gas insulated switchgear lies the innovative use of SF6 gas, a highly effective insulating and arc-quenching medium. During normal operations, the breaker contacts remain closed, allowing seamless current flow. However, when a fault occurs, the contacts separate, creating an arc. Synchronized with this movement, a valve releases high-pressure SF6 gas into the chamber, swiftly extinguishing the arc and safeguarding the system. This mechanism ensures minimal downtime and enhanced operational efficiency.

Why Gas Insulated Switchgear is a Preferred Choice

The compact design of gas insulated switchgear makes it an ideal choice for space-constrained environments, such as urban power substations. Unlike traditional air-insulated systems, GIS requires significantly less space while delivering higher reliability. Furthermore, the robust insulation properties of SF6 gas reduce the risk of electrical failures, making GIS a dependable solution for high-voltage applications.
